First stop, a half-open field with Oak trees and shrubs. The land seemed heavily ploughed, but most likely this was the work of wild swines. Remarkably, we found quite some orchids in these 'ploughed' fields (Cephalanthera spec.). Another interesting find was wild Paeonia.
